UMA Supports Nomination of Hersman for NTSB Chair
The United Motorcoach Association is pleased to give President Obama’s nomination of Deborah Hersman to National Transportation Safety Board Chair its full support and endorsement. The National Transportation Safety Board (NTSB) is an independent Federal agency charged by Congress with investigating aviation, railroad, highway and marine accidents, as well as issuing safety recommendations aimed at preventing future accidents.
“It is a great pleasure to support Deborah Hersman’s nomination to Chair the NTSB,” noted Victor S. Parra, UMA’s President & CEO. “Since her appointment to the NTSB in 2004, she has been a strong advocate of bus and motorcoach safety, and her first hand knowledge and practical experience will continue to be a great asset to the Board.”
Ms. Hersman has demonstrated an exceptional understanding of our industry and headed several bus and motorcoach crash investigations including the August, 2008, crash of a chartered motorcoach in Sherman, Texas; the November, 2006, school bus crash in Huntsville, Alabama; and the April, 2005, collision of a school bus with a trash truck in Arlington, Virginia, as well as having chaired the October, 2008 public hearing on the January, 2008, motorcoach accident in Victoria, Texas. UMA honored Ms. Hersman in 2005 for her support of coach industry safety initiatives during her years as Senior Professional Staff Member of the U.S. Senate Committee on Commerce, Science and Transportation (1999 – 2004).
“UMA and our members have always put passenger safety first,” added Parra, “and we look forward to working with nominee Hersman to continue working towards the common goal of improved bus and motorcoach safety.”
The United Motorcoach Association is North America's largest association for operators of motorcoach companies providing charter, tour and regular route services. Founded in 1971, UMA is comprised of over 1,200 members located all across North America, with more than 925 charter and tour bus operator members who provide transportation services in all fifty states, Canada and Mexico. Headquartered in Alexandria, VA, UMA is dedicated to protecting and promoting the interests of the entire motorcoach industry and providing its members with programs and services to enhance the success of their operations.
